Lie algebra for rotational subsystems of a driven asymmetric top
(2022-05-11)
We present an analytical approach to construct the Lie algebra of finite-dimensional subsystems of the driven asymmetric top rotor. Each rotational level is degenerate due to the isotropy of space, and the degeneracy increases with rotational excitation. For a given rotational excitation, we determine the nested commutators between drift and drive Hamiltonians using a graph representation. We then generate the Lie algebra for subsystems with arbitrary rotational excitation using an inductive argument.

The relevance of herders’ local ecological knowledge on coping with livestock losses during harsh winters in western Mongolia
(2018-01-29)
In many regions of the world, traditional and local ecological knowledge is still important today for coping with environmental challenges. This study explored the relevance of such knowledge for predicting and coping with harsh winter conditions (dzud) in a remote area of western Mongolia, where government support to disaster-affected herders is restricted by weak infrastructure. Genetic diversity and differentiation of Olea europaea subsp. cuspidata (Wall. & G.Don) Cif. in the Hajar Mountains of Oman
(2020-10-04)
Olea europaea subsp. cuspidata (Wall. & G. Don) Cif. is one of the six subspecies important for domestication of olive described as having valuable breeding traits. It is distributed from South Africa to the Middle East and the Mediterranean region to China mainly at mid to high altitudes with adequate precipitation. ‘Nach und nach müssen wir alles ablehnen’: Hyperbolische Negativität bei Thomas Bernhard
(2021-02-02)
Thomas Bernhard's work abounds in rejections. The impulse of not wanting to participate, of refusing to be complicit, lies at the heart of Bernhard's oeuvre. If this refusal is frequently embedded in discursive or even programmatic strategies, it really seems to undermine its own foundations, the very arguments and justifications put forward to make the refusal possible. Numerical simulation of flow processes of wood‐polymer in extrusion dies
(2021-01-25)
The addition of wood to polymers results in wood‐polymer composites (WPC), whereby the wood content can be up to 80 %. This composite is mainly processed in extruded deckings. The extrusion die is an essential part of the process, which determines both process parameters and the final product. A characteristic of WPC extrusion dies is a partial solidification of the melt before leaving the die. This solidification is necessary to ensure a dimensionally stable extrusion. The influence of magnetic field on nanoparticle transport in a micro channel
(2021-01-25)
The present study focuses on a new solver considering the effect of magnetic field on nanoparticles concentration in a micro size channel. To describe the multi component behavior of blood, the Euler‐Euler method is used. Particles are modeled by a concentration equation considering a magnetic drift. The influence of a realistic magnetic field on nanoparticles is investigated. A result for a test case is presented. The J-integral for mixed-mode loaded cracks with cohesive zones
(2020-11-23)
The J-integral quantifies the loading of a crack tip, just as the crack tip opening displacement (CTOD) emanating from the cohesive zone model. Both quantities, being based on fundamentally different interpretations of cracks in fracture mechanics of brittle or ductile materials, have been proven to be equivalent in the late 60s of the previous century, however, just for the simple mode-I loading case. Numerical Simulation of Viscoelastic Fluid‐Structure Interaction Problems and Drug Therapy in the Eye
(2021-01-25)
The vitreous is a fluid‐like viscoelastic transparent medium located in the center of the human eye and is surrounded by hyperelastic structures like the sclera, lens and iris. This naturally gives rise to a fluid‐structure interaction (FSI) problem. While the healthy vitreous is viscoelastic and described by a viscoelastic Burgers‐type equation, the aging vitreous liquefies and is therefore modeled by the Navier‐Stokes equations.
